Application of Hydrodynamic Simulation to Flood Discharge Analysis of Rivers with Spoil Dumps
Spoil dump is an important problem in soil and water conservation schemes for hydropower cascadedevelopment.Improper setting of spoil dumps can easily narrow the river channel and influence river flooddischarge.Aiming at this question
a new calculating method based on numerical simulation of river flow wasproposed.Using the hydrodynamics module in MIKE 21model
changes of water level and flow field wereobtained by two-dimensional simulation before and after the existence of spoil dumps.This method solvedthe hydraulic calculation problem in soil and water conservation schemes
especially in areas lacking hydrological data and engineering experience.It also provided technological evidence for soil and water conservation engineering measure design on spoil dumps.
